this PR enables UI to improve "Saved messages" hugely, bringing it on
WhatsApp's "Starred Messages" or Telegram's "Saved Messages" level. with
this PR, UIs can add the following functionality with few effort ([~100
loc on iOS](https://github.com/deltachat/deltachat-ios/pull/2527)):

- add a "Save" button in the messages context menu, allowing to save a
message
- show directly in the chat if a message was saved, eg. by a little star
★
- in "Saved Messages", show the message in its context - so with author,
avatar, date and keep incoming/outgoing state
- in "Saved Messages", a button to go to the original message can be
added
- if the original message was deleted, one can still go to the original
chat

these features were often requested, in the forum, but also in many
one-to-one discussions, recently at the global gathering.

moreover, in contrast to the old method with "forward to saved", no
traffic is wasted - the messages are saved locally, and only a small
sync messages is sent around

technically, still a copy is done from the original message (with
already now deduplicated blobs), so that things work nicely with
deletion modes; eg. you can save an important message and preserve it
from deletion that way.

while working on this PR, there was also the idea to just set a flag
“starred” in the message table and not copy anything. however, while
tempting, that would result in more complexity, questions and drawbacks
in UI:

- delete-message, delete-chat, auto-deletion, clear-chat would raise
questions - what do do with the “Starred”? having a copy in “Saved
Messages” does not raise this question
- newly saved messages appear naturally as “new” in “Saved Messages”,
simply setting a flag would show them somewhere in between - unless we
do additional effort
- “Saved Messages” already has its place in the UI - and allows to
_directly_ save things there as well - not easily doable with “starring”
- one would need to re-do many things that already exist in “Saved
Messages”, at least in core
- one idea to solve some of the issues could be to have “Starred” as
well as “Saved Messages” - however, that would irritate user, one would
remember exactly what was done with a message, and understand the fine
differences

whatsapp does this “starred”, btw, so when original is deleted, starred
is deleted as well. Telegram does things similar to us, Signal does
nothing. Whatsapp has a per-chat view for starred messages - if needed,
we could do sth. like that as well, however, let’s first see how far the
“all view” goes (in contrast to whatsapp, we have profiles for
separation as well)

for the wording: “saving” is what we’re doing here, this is much more on
point as “starring” - which is more the idea of a “bookmark”, and i
think, whatsapp uses this wording to not raise false expectations
(still, i know of ppl that were quite upset that a “starred” message was
deleted when eg. the chat was cleared to save some memory)

wrt webxdc app updates: options that come into mind were: _empty_ (as
now), _snapshot_ (copy all updates) or _shortcut_ (always open
original). i am not sure what the best solution is, the easiest was
_empty_, so i went for that, as it is (a) obvious, and what is already
done with forwarding and (b) the original is easy to open now (in
contrast to forwarding).
so, might totally be that we need or want to tweak things here, but i
would leave that outside the first iteration, things are not worsened in
that area

wrt reactions: as things are detached, similar to webxdc updates, we do
not not to show the original reactions - that way, one can use reactions
for private markers (telegram is selling that feature :)

to the icon: a disk or a bookmark might be other options, but the star
is nicer and also know from other apps - and anyways a but vague UX
wise. so i think, it is fine

finally, known issue is that if a message was saved that does not exist
on another device, it does not get there. i think, that issue is a weak
one, and can be ignored mostly, most times, user will save messages soon
after receiving, and if on some devices auto-deletion is done, it is
maybe not even expected to have suddenly another copy there

impl Sql {
async fn set_db_version(&self, version: i32) -> Result<()> {
self.set_raw_config_int(VERSION_CFG, version).await?;
Ok(())
}
// Sets db `version` in the `transaction`.
fn set_db_version_trans(transaction: &mut rusqlite::Transaction, version: i32) -> Result<()> {
transaction.execute(
"UPDATE config SET value=? WHERE keyname=?;",
(format!("{version}"), VERSION_CFG),
)?;
Ok(())
}
async fn set_db_version_in_cache(&self, version: i32) -> Result<()> {
let mut lock = self.config_cache.write().await;
lock.insert(VERSION_CFG.to_string(), Some(format!("{version}")));
Ok(())
}
async fn execute_migration(&self, query: &str, version: i32) -> Result<()> {
self.transaction(move |transaction| {
let curr_version: String = transaction.query_row(
"SELECT IFNULL(value, ?) FROM config WHERE keyname=?;",
("0", VERSION_CFG),
|row| row.get(0),
)?;
let curr_version: i32 = curr_version.parse()?;
ensure!(curr_version < version, "Db version must be increased");
Self::set_db_version_trans(transaction, version)?;
transaction.execute_batch(query)?;
Ok(())
})
.await
.with_context(|| format!("execute_migration failed for version {version}"))?;
self.config_cache.write().await.clear();
Ok(())
}
}
